Course Description

This course prepares students for practice as an entry-level professional massage therapist. Successful completion of Therapeutic Massage I is required to take this course. Coursework includes; kinesiology, communication skills, pain relief and stress management massage techniques through coursework, hands-on lab experience, and public massage clinics. Upon successful completion of Massage Therapy Parts I & II students are eligible for the NC State Board of Massage Therapy licensing exam. (Mblex).

Learner Outcomes

Upon successful completion of the course, students will be able to:

  • Administer a professional massage in a clinical environment.
  • Gain knowledge and understanding of the human body, anatomy and physiology.

Notes

A textbook along with supplies and a uniform is required.  A list of specific supplies will be provided during the first class. 

Prerequisites

A high school diploma or equivalency is required. 

To enroll in this course, students must have successfully completed Therapeutic Massage I, MTH-3021M2.  Students must complete both  Therapeutic Massage I and II successfully to be eligible to sit for the State Mblex exam.
